Who supports dog adoption? Jets Coach Rex Ryan does!
Posted 9/23/2012 4:02:00 PM

Whenever I meet rockers or celebrities, the subject of their dogs always comes up. (Usually it's me asking, quite frankly I don't trust anyone who doesn't like dogs...) I recently interviewed Nils Lofgren of the E Street Band and we spent time AFTER the interview discussing his love for his 6 canines. Slash told me he works hard to support many animal charities as I discussed Rock N' Ruff with him, Brent from Shinedown told me he misses his Bulldog Bella when he's on the road and Chris from Black Stone Cherry wants to add a Pit Bull to his family!

So....where does Rex Ryan fit in?? Last year, I hosted The Home For Good Dog Rescue "Bark A Que" at the Village Green in Summit and had a great time. I was quite surprised when out of nowhere they asked me to bring Jets Head Coach Rex Ryan up on stage with his dog....JET to greet the crowd. Rex was fantastic. Friendly, took pictures etc. You see, Jet was adopted by Rex and his wife from Home For Good. He is a great supporter of the group and of dog adoption.

Fast forward to 2 weeks ago. I'm hosting the Bark A Que again. And who shows up (even with a tornado warning in effect) to give ANOTHER homeless Home For Good pooch a forever home ........REX!  Yes......adopting a second dog so Jet can have a companion. Coach Rex could have filled out an application online and had his dog delivered to him, but he didn't. He came out, supported a great rescue group and even had his new pup microchipped onsite and took pictures and chatted with people. Listen, love the team you love....I get it..I'm not trying to convert you to "Jetsism"..but I had to give props to a guy who supports homeless animals, our local groups, and flies under the radar doing it (and jeeze....what a lucky dog!)

Home For Good quoted Rex as saying "There is nothing better than saving the life of a rescue dog".......I agree!

Here's a picture of Rex, Mrs. Rex and sweet Dixie. A great story for this dog for sure.
